Gwent Bat Group

There are over 90 local Bat Groups in the UK – some large and formal – some small and informal but whatever the size those who are involved all have a certain ‘love’ of and respect for bats with an ultimate goal of conserving them, their roosts and their habitats. There are a variety of ways of achieving this. Because not everyone views them with the same fascination there is a need to improve their public image and this can be done through walks and talks and by providing an informal information ‘service’ to those members of the public who look upon bats in the same way as they do the poor old spiders.
